Over the past few decades, the definition of innovation has steadily broadened to include not only products and processes, but services, experiences, and more recently business models. From subscription services to home delivery to the sharing economy, business model innovation has profoundly changed the industries where it has blossomed.
However, business model transformation is only half the story for companies—an equally revised organizational design is required. Join Senior Associate Dean for Executive Education, Peter Hirst, and MIT Sloan Senior Lecturer Bill Fischer for a live discussion. Topics covered will include:
- What’s next on the innovation frontier
- A look at how organizational transformation can complement new, innovative business models
- How changing the business model requires you to examine whether the old organization is still fit for purpose
